Albright used a big second half to hand the Misericordia University men's basketball team its third straight loss, 86-69, Wednesday.
Ethan Eichhorst led the Cougars with 22 points and a game-high 11 rebounds.
Robbie Johnson had 16 points and
Jeff Slanovec added 10.
Trailing 35-28 at halftime,
Frank Nutt and
Matt Greene both drained three-pointers to get MU within three early in the second half.
Albright responded and stretched the lead to 73-57 to take control of the game.
